Pet Shop is located in Palakkad City, Palakkad. Currently we do not have any reviews or rating for Pet Shop. There are at least 20 Shopping malls in Palakkad City, out of which this Shopping mall has an overall rank of 8. Address of the Shopping mall is Koppam, Palakkad, Kerala 678014.
Pet Shop - Palakkad City - Palakkad - Kerala - Complete Information
There are 7 Shopping malls within 1 km radius of Pet Shop. When you increase the radius to 5 Km or 10 Km, you will find 14 and 14 Shopping malls respectively. You would also like to view:
People of Palakkad City have several options when it comes to a good Shopping malls. In this area, there are 20 Shopping malls . There are several good Shopping malls in this area which are more popular than Pet Shop. Some of the most popular ones are :–